ABOUT THE MILLENNIUM FELLOWSHIP - CLASS OF 2023
United Nations Academic Impact and MCN are proud to partner on the Millennium Fellowship. 44,000+ student leaders from 3,300+ campuses across 170+ nations applied to join the Class of 2023. 260+ campuses worldwide (just 9%) in 38 countries were selected to host 4,000+ Millennium Fellows for the Class of 2023.

Millennium Fellowship Project: Girl Up Initiative
The Girl Up Initiative is a team project by Millennium fellowship;Mamman Oyinnoiza and Odediran Jesutofunmi which focuses on Female Health&Hygiene,Menstrual hygiene and sex education.The project aims at educating 10-16years old girls on female hygiene,menstrual hygiene and sex education in my community and other states eventually.
During the millennium fellowship period,the Girl Up Initiative will organize 6 outreaches to 2 schools in Kwara State community,Abuja State and Lagos state and respectively. At these schools outreaches talks,discussions and private counseling on female hygiene,menstrual hygiene and sex education will be delivered.Also,sanitary pads and hygiene packages will be given to all the girls in attendance.We aim at reaching 1600 girls combined in all the outreaches
